DescriptionCloud Firestore is an auto-scaling document database for storing, syncing, and querying data for mobile and web apps. It offers seamless integration with other Firebase and Google Cloud Platform products.A cloud-native analytic database platform with new technologoy for elastic MPPOpen Source Operational and Transactional Enterprise NoSQL Document Database
